In the early days, vacuum insulated panels primarily utilized silica as their core material. While silica offered excellent thermal insulation properties, it was also inherently fragile. Manufacturers faced a significant challenge: how to create a product that combined insulation efficiency with strength. Many of you may recall encounters with fragile items that seem to break if you so much as look at them the wrong way; that was the reality of early VIPs. To address this issue, innovations began to emerge.

One of the critical advancements in the evolution of vacuum insulated panels was the introduction of robust materials and cladding techniques. Instead of relying solely on silica, manufacturers started to explore options that could withstand harsher conditions while maintaining thermal performance. For instance, metal cladding has become a popular choice due to its durability. Imagine trying to build a fortress out of sand; it’s much easier when you have a solid foundation and protective armor. Metal-clad VIPs provide that essential protection, ensuring panels can endure both physical stress and environmental challenges.
